Transaction e901eb8b656215998d62667409566ab7fddca6b6a4d7606d2ddac8bd4315ba79
1 Input
1 Output
-
e901eb8b656215998d62667409566ab7fddca6b6a4d7606d2ddac8bd4315ba79:0
- value
- 289703
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c7e922e76516472cfb9e453e3ffc4d8ecc47564
- address
- bc1q83lfytnk29j89naeu3f78l7ymrkvgatyme5z0e